Spam protection via hCaptcha

To protect our contact form against automated entries (spam, abuse), we use the hCaptcha service. The provider is Intuition Machines, Inc., 350 Alabama St, San Francisco, CA 94110, USA. hCaptcha checks whether the data entry on our form is made by a human and not by automated programs. For this purpose, hCaptcha analyses various information (e.g. the IP address, information about the device and browser used, and the user’s behaviour while interacting with the form). The data collected is transmitted to and processed by Intuition Machines.

The legal basis is Art. 6 (1) (f) GDPR; our legitimate interest lies in protecting our website against abusive automated use and spam. Where data is transferred to the USA, this is based on the EU Commission’s standard contractual clauses. 7. Google Fonts

To ensure a uniform presentation of fonts, this website uses web fonts provided by Google. When you open a page, your browser loads the required fonts into your browser cache in order to display text and fonts correctly. For this purpose, the browser you use must connect to Google’s servers. This enables Google to know that this website has been accessed via your IP address.

The provider is Google Ireland Limited, Gordon House, Barrow Street, Dublin 4, Ireland. The use of Google Fonts is in the interest of a uniform and appealing presentation of our website. This constitutes a legitimate interest within the meaning of Art. 6 (1) (f) GDPR. Where data is transferred to Google servers in the USA, this is based on the EU Commission’s standard contractual clauses.
